Transaction f61287521af941715c8e3514471c078968d114c50e6222b58b118a8bd083bec2

1 Input
2 Outputs
  • f61287521af941715c8e3514471c078968d114c50e6222b58b118a8bd083bec2:0
  • value  2970000
    address  395BKVQ24Hi9mvFVrbyLbHjugLkatVXKLy
  • f61287521af941715c8e3514471c078968d114c50e6222b58b118a8bd083bec2:1
  • value  70668083
    address  bc1qj2hddmymf4llvux2uc5ydh5y5wtf27nz6nl3fvz8n34xg3unrj8s6e4hel